About Singer Finance (Lanka) Plc

Singer Finance (Lanka) PLC is a Sri Lanka-based financial services company that provides lending, leasing and other financing solutions through a national branch network and digital channels. The Company supports both personal and enterprise financial needs, enabling consumer purchases and business asset finance across the country. Its core activities include lending operations and asset leasing, with a particular focus on vehicle financing within its broader lending portfolio, alongside deposit-taking and funding management to support balance sheet liquidity. The business is supported by centralised support functions, digital channels and a branch footprint that serve customers across Sri Lanka. Singer Finance emphasises governance, risk management and digital innovation in its operations and positions itself as a provider of accessible finance to support personal aspirations and enterprise activity within the Sri Lankan market.

Singer Finance asset base tops Rs. 100 b

Singer Finance (Lanka) PLC's total asset base exceeded Rs.100 billion in Q1 of the 2026/27 financial year, based on unaudited management accounts. The managing director thanked stakeholders for their continued trust and support.

Banking veteran Jonathan Alles joins Singer Finance Board

Singer Finance (Lanka) PLC appointed former HNB MD/CEO Jonathan Alles as a Non-Independent Non-Executive Director, approved by the Board on 23 Dec 2025 and by the Central Bank on 5 Mar 2026. Alles has over 37 years of banking experience and a First Class MBA in Finance.

Thushan Amarasuriya appointed Singer Finance Managing Director

Singer Finance (Lanka) PLC appointed Thushan Amarasuriya as Managing Director effective 1 January 2026; the board approved the appointment on 25 November 2025 and the Central Bank approved it on 24 December 2025.

Singer Finance lists 75.7 m new shares from Rs. 2 b rights issue

Singer Finance (Lanka) PLC listed 75.7 million new ordinary voting shares from its 2025 rights issue, raising over Rs. 2 billion; the shares were listed on 14 October 2025. The capital raise is expected to strengthen the company’s balance sheet and support expansion plans.
